After brainstorming with Slicer a little bit, I have a similar solution for you since the spring rate and travel is different from the older kits.

The original new Kw clubsport spring has a spring rate of 110-170 and a travel travel of 86mm, and it is 6.6" Long (170mm).

I just got off the phone with Eibach, and the travel of the HRS-140-60-110 (110nmm, 140mm long) is also 86mm. This is due to the wire diameter and coil spacing being smaller.

So effectively, you can change to this shorter spring and gain 1.1" of clearance away from the tire, and technically not change the way the damper responds to the spring at all. They have the same exact spring travel. Which, is freakin awesome.

You can also scoop up a set of these springs for less than 140 shipped from Jegs. http://www.jegs.com/i/Eibach/369/140-60-0110/10002/-1

I will be installing mine this week, will report back if there are any issues (which i cannot see happening). Thought I would share!
